Remove-AzRecoveryServicesBackupProtectionPolicy
Hiermee verwijdert u een back-upbeveiligingsbeleid uit een kluis.
Syntaxis
Remove-AzRecoveryServicesBackupProtectionPolicy
[-Name] <String>
[-PassThru]
[-Force]
[-VaultId <String>]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Remove-AzRecoveryServicesBackupProtectionPolicy
[-Policy] <PolicyBase>
[-PassThru]
[-Force]
[-VaultId <String>]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
De Remove-AzRecoveryServicesBackupProtectionPolicy cmdlet verwijdert back-upbeleid voor een kluis. Voordat u een back-upbeveiligingsbeleid kunt verwijderen, mag het beleid geen gekoppelde back-upitems hebben. Voordat u het beleid verwijdert, moet u ervoor zorgen dat elk gekoppeld item is gekoppeld aan een ander beleid. Als u een ander beleid wilt koppelen aan een back-upitem, gebruikt u de cmdlet Enable-AzRecoveryServicesBackupProtection. Stel de kluiscontext in met behulp van de Set-AzRecoveryServicesVaultContext-cmdlet voordat u de huidige cmdlet gebruikt.
Voorbeelden
Voorbeeld 1: Een beleid verwijderen
$Pol= Get-AzRecoveryServicesBackupProtectionPolicy -Name "NewPolicy"
Remove-AzRecoveryServicesBackupProtectionPolicy -Policy $Pol
Met de eerste opdracht wordt het back-upbeveiligingsbeleid met de naam NewPolicy opgeslagen en vervolgens opgeslagen in de variabele $Pol. Met de tweede opdracht wordt het beleidsobject in $Pol verwijderd.
Voorbeeld 2
Hiermee verwijdert u een back-upbeveiligingsbeleid uit een kluis. (automatisch gegenereerd)
Remove-AzRecoveryServicesBackupProtectionPolicy -Name 'V2VM' -VaultId $vault.ID
Parameters
-Confirm
U wordt gevraagd om bevestiging voordat u de cmdlet uitvoert.
Type: | SwitchParameter |
Aliassen: | cf |
Position: | Named |
Default value: | False |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-DefaultProfile
De referenties, het account, de tenant en het abonnement die worden gebruikt voor communicatie met Azure.
Type: | IAzureContextContainer |
Aliassen: | AzContext, AzureRmContext, AzureCredential |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-Force
Hiermee dwingt u de opdracht uit te voeren zonder dat u om bevestiging van de gebruiker wordt gevraagd.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-Name
Hiermee geeft u de naam van het back-upbeveiligingsbeleid dat moet worden verwijderd.
Type: | String |
Position: | 1 |
Default value: | None |
Vereist: | True |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-PassThru
Retourneer het beleid dat moet worden verwijderd.
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
-Policy
Hiermee geeft u het back-upbeveiligingsbeleid op dat moet worden verwijderd. Als u een BackupPolicy--object wilt verkrijgen, gebruikt u de cmdlet Get-AzRecoveryServicesBackupProtectionPolicy.
Type: | PolicyBase |
Position: | 1 |
Default value: | None |
Vereist: | True |
Pijplijninvoer accepteren: | True |
Jokertekens accepteren: | False |
-VaultId
ARM-id van de Recovery Services-kluis.
Type: | String |
Position: | Named |
Default value: | None |
Vereist: | False |
Pijplijninvoer accepteren: | True |
Jokertekens accepteren: | False |
-WhatIf
Toont wat er zou gebeuren als de cmdlet wordt uitgevoerd.
Type: | SwitchParameter |
Aliassen: | wi |
Position: | Named |
Default value: | False |
Vereist: | False |
Pijplijninvoer accepteren: | False |
Jokertekens accepteren: | False |
Invoerwaarden
Uitvoerwaarden
Verwante koppelingen
Azure PowerShell